1. LinkedIn – The Leading Platform for B2B Growth

LinkedIn continues to dominate professional networking and remains the most valuable platform for B2B marketing.

Why LinkedIn Works

  • Highly targeted professional audience
  • Excellent organic reach for thought leadership
  • Advanced advertising capabilities
  • Strong lead-generation opportunities

Best Use Cases

  • B2B lead generation
  • Employer branding
  • Industry insights
  • Company updates
  • Professional networking
  • Educational content

LinkedIn is particularly valuable for SaaS companies, consultants, agencies, technology firms, and service-based businesses.


2. Instagram – Visual Marketing That Drives Engagement

Instagram remains one of the most influential social media platforms for consumer brands.

Its combination of Reels, Stories, shopping features, and creator partnerships makes it ideal for visual storytelling.

Why Instagram Works

  • High engagement rates
  • Strong creator ecosystem
  • Excellent visual branding opportunities
  • Built-in shopping features
  • Large active user base

Best Use Cases

  • Product launches
  • Brand storytelling
  • Lifestyle marketing
  • Influencer collaborations
  • Community building
  • eCommerce marketing

Industries such as fashion, beauty, travel, fitness, food, and retail continue to benefit significantly from Instagram marketing.


3. YouTube – The Largest Video Search Platform

YouTube remains one of the most valuable long-term marketing channels because its content continues generating traffic long after publication.

Unlike many social platforms, YouTube videos can rank in both YouTube Search and Google Search.

Why YouTube Works

  • Evergreen content lifespan
  • Strong search visibility
  • High trust-building potential
  • Excellent educational platform
  • Supports long-form content

Best Use Cases

  • Tutorials
  • Product demonstrations
  • Educational videos
  • Customer success stories
  • Webinars
  • Industry insights

Businesses investing in high-quality video content often see long-term returns through continuous organic traffic.


4. TikTok – The Discovery Platform

TikTok has transformed social media by prioritizing content quality over follower count.

Its recommendation algorithm allows businesses of every size to achieve significant organic reach.

Why TikTok Works

  • Exceptional organic visibility
  • Highly engaging short-form videos
  • Fast audience growth
  • Strong Gen Z and Millennial presence
  • Creative storytelling opportunities

Best Use Cases

  • Brand awareness
  • Behind-the-scenes content
  • Product showcases
  • Industry trends
  • User-generated content
  • Small business promotion

For startups and growing businesses, TikTok provides one of the fastest ways to increase brand visibility without large advertising budgets.


5. Facebook – Still a Powerful Advertising Platform

Although newer platforms continue to grow, Facebook remains an essential marketing channel for businesses.

Its advertising capabilities, community groups, and integration with Instagram continue to deliver strong marketing results.

Why Facebook Works

  • Advanced audience targeting
  • Powerful advertising platform
  • Large user base
  • Active community groups
  • Local business visibility

Best Use Cases

  • Paid advertising
  • Local business marketing
  • Event promotion
  • Customer communities
  • Retargeting campaigns
  • Brand awareness

Facebook remains especially effective for businesses targeting local markets and mature customer segments.

How to Choose the Right Social Media Channels for Your Business

Not every social media platform is suitable for every business. The right choice depends on your audience, industry, marketing objectives, and available resources. Instead of trying to maintain a presence on every platform, focus on the channels where your target customers are most active.

Consider These Factors

  • Target Audience: Identify where your ideal customers spend their time online.
  • Business Type: B2B companies often perform better on LinkedIn, while B2C brands typically see higher engagement on Instagram and TikTok.
  • Content Format: Choose platforms that align with your content strategy, whether it’s videos, images, blogs, or live sessions.
  • Marketing Goals: Select channels based on objectives such as brand awareness, lead generation, customer engagement, or sales.
  • Budget: Determine how much you can invest in organic content and paid advertising.

A focused strategy across two or three relevant platforms often delivers better results than spreading resources too thin.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Many businesses struggle with social media because they overlook strategic planning. Avoid these common mistakes:

  • Trying to be active on every platform.
  • Posting inconsistent or low-quality content.
  • Ignoring audience engagement.
  • Focusing only on promotions instead of providing value.
  • Neglecting analytics and performance tracking.
  • Failing to adapt content for different platforms.

Consistency, authenticity, and understanding your audience are key to long-term success.
